test_alternate_witness_tx mines the taproot funding output on node0 with sync_fun=self.no_op and immediately disconnects. node1 later includes the script-path spend via generateblock. If the funding block has not reached node1, that call fails with bad-txns-inputs-missingorspent. Drop the no_op so generate() uses the default sync_all before the partition. def test_alternate_witness_tx(self):
|
|
self.log.info("Test gettransaction and listtransactions report alternate witnesses and canonical variant")
|
|
self.nodes[0].createwallet("altwit")
|
|
default_wallet = self.nodes[0].get_wallet_rpc(self.default_wallet_name)
|
|
wallet = self.nodes[0].get_wallet_rpc("altwit")
|
|
|
|
xprvs = [ExtendedPrivateKey.generate() for _ in range(0, 2)]
|
|
xpubs = [xprv.pubkey() for xprv in xprvs]
|
|
|
|
# Import a taproot descriptor with script paths
|
|
desc = descsum_create(f"tr({xpubs[0].to_string()}/*,pk({xprvs[1].to_string()}/*))")
|
|
assert_equal(wallet.importdescriptors([{"desc": desc, "active": True, "timestamp": "now"}])[0]["success"], True)
|
|
default_wallet.sendtoaddress(wallet.getnewaddress(address_type="bech32m"), 1)
|
|
self.generate(self.nodes[0], 1)
|
|
# Isolate node0 for later reorg coverage
|
|
self.disconnect_nodes(0, 1)
|
|
self.disconnect_nodes(0, 2)
|
|
|
|
# Create output psbt
|
|
psbt = wallet.walletcreatefundedpsbt(outputs=[{default_wallet.getnewaddress(): 0.5}])["psbt"]
|
|
|
|
# Create a script path spend and relay it. With only one variant known it
|
|
# is trivially canonical and has no alternates
|
|
self.log.info("Test the only known variant is canonical with no alternates")
|
|
script_path_psbt = wallet.walletprocesspsbt(psbt=psbt, finalize=False)["psbt"]
|
|
script_path_tx, script_path_wtxid = self.finalize_tx_variant(wallet, script_path_psbt, spend_path="script")
|
|
txid = self.nodes[0].sendrawtransaction(script_path_tx)
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, script_path_tx, script_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[])
|
|
|
|
# Make a key path spend separate from the wallet
|
|
key_path_desc = descsum_create(f"tr({xprvs[0].to_string()}/*,pk({xpubs[1].to_string()}/*))")
|
|
key_path_psbt = self.nodes[0].descriptorprocesspsbt(psbt=psbt, descriptors=[{"desc": key_path_desc}], finalize=False)["psbt"]
|
|
key_path_tx, key_path_wtxid = self.finalize_tx_variant(wallet, key_path_psbt, spend_path="key")
|
|
|
|
# Ensure variants share the same txid but differ in wtxid, and the key path is the lighter of the two
|
|
assert_equal(txid, self.nodes[0].decoderawtransaction(key_path_tx)["txid"])
|
|
assert_not_equal(script_path_wtxid, key_path_wtxid)
|
|
assert_greater_than(
|
|
self.nodes[0].decoderawtransaction(script_path_tx)["weight"],
|
|
self.nodes[0].decoderawtransaction(key_path_tx)["weight"],
|
|
)
|
|
|
|
# The wallet only learns the key path witness from a block (the mempool
|
|
# holds one transaction per txid). Mine the key path: a confirmed variant
|
|
# is canonical, with the script path now listed as its alternate.
|
|
block = self.generateblock(self.nodes[0], default_wallet.getnewaddress(), [key_path_tx], sync_fun=self.no_op)["hash"]
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, key_path_tx, key_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[script_path_wtxid])
|
|
|
|
# Reorg that block out so both variants are known and unconfirmed. With no
|
|
# confirmation to force the choice, the lighter key path is canonical.
|
|
self.log.info("Test the lighter variant is canonical when both are known and unconfirmed")
|
|
self.nodes[0].invalidateblock(block)
|
|
self.nodes[0].syncwithvalidationinterfacequeue()
|
|
assert_equal(wallet.gettransaction(txid)["confirmations"], 0)
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, key_path_tx, key_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[script_path_wtxid])
|
|
|
|
# The canonical choice and alternates survive a wallet reload
|
|
wallet.unloadwallet()
|
|
self.nodes[0].loadwallet("altwit")
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, key_path_tx, key_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[script_path_wtxid])
|
|
|
|
# Now confirm the heavier script path instead, on a longer competing chain
|
|
# from node1, and reconnect so node0 reorgs onto it. The confirmed variant
|
|
# is canonical even though it is the heavier one.
|
|
self.log.info("Test a confirmed variant is canonical even when it is the heavier one")
|
|
self.generate(self.nodes[1], 3, sync_fun=self.no_op)
|
|
block = self.generateblock(self.nodes[1], default_wallet.getnewaddress(), [script_path_tx], sync_fun=self.no_op)["hash"]
|
|
self.connect_nodes(0, 1)
|
|
self.connect_nodes(0, 2)
|
|
self.sync_all()
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, script_path_tx, script_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[key_path_wtxid])
|
|
|
|
# The confirmed-canonical choice survive a reload
|
|
wallet.unloadwallet()
|
|
self.nodes[0].loadwallet("altwit")
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, script_path_tx, script_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[key_path_wtxid])
|
|
|
|
self.log.info("Test canonical reverts to the lighter variant when the confirmed one is reorged out")
|
|
# Both variants are unconfirmed again, so the lighter key path is canonical once more
|
|
self.disconnect_nodes(0, 1)
|
|
self.disconnect_nodes(0, 2)
|
|
self.nodes[0].invalidateblock(block)
|
|
self.nodes[0].syncwithvalidationinterfacequeue()
|
|
assert_equal(wallet.gettransaction(txid)["confirmations"], 0)
|
|
self.check_tx_variants(wallet, txid, key_path_tx, key_path_wtxid, alternate_wtxids=[script_path_wtxid])
|
|
|
|
# listsinceblock "removed" entries reflect the wallet's current CWalletTx, not a
|
|
# snapshot of the detached block. The detached block contained the heavier script
|
|
# path variant, but "wtxid" reports the current canonical (key path) variant and
|
|
# the script path variant appears under "alternate_wtxids". A future improvement
|
|
# could track which specific variant was in the detached block and report that.
|
|
removed = next(e for e in wallet.listsinceblock(block)["removed"] if e["txid"] == txid)
|
|
assert_equal(removed["confirmations"], 0)
|
|
assert_equal(removed["wtxid"], key_path_wtxid)
|
|
assert_equal(removed["alternate_wtxids"], [script_path_wtxid])
